You are going to be busy. The 7 plus years that I spent with the 101st ABN DIV are some of the best years I have had in the military, and they were some of the roughest too. The Division maintains a good battle rhythm with their cycles and you will see a little bit of everything from the field to the desk and plenty of road time.
There are a lot of young Soldiers there and they are full of Hoooah and moral, that can tend to lead to silliness and keep you busy. Good luck and enjoy your time.

It was great when I was there, it was my first duty station. I PCS a year and a half ago. It's close to Nashville which is where most Soldiers tent to go on the weekend. Depending on the unit during your three day and four day weekends you can drive to several place like Atlanta, St. Louis, Louisville, Gatlingburg and so on. As far as being in the MP unit I know you will be working different shifts, we did a few class for the MP unit while I was there. But other than that I was in a Combat Operational Stress Control unit that fell under the Combat Support Hospital there. It will be nice that you can visit family only being an hour away. Hope you like it there, I know I enjoyed it.
